Web24 aug. 2024 · Impaired Comfort Care Plan . Patients suffering from migraines and other types of headaches often experience impaired comfort. Impaired comfort refers to an apparent lack of relief and peace in relation to a person’s physiological, environmental, spiritual, intellectual, and social patterns. Cognitive-behavioral therapy is a short-term treatment for insomnia with 3 phases: 1) Sleep restriction, 2) stimulus control training, 3) cognitive therapy (Nursingcenter 2014). Phase 1 sets the goal to have the patient fall asleep in 30 minutes or less for a period of 7 nights. commandworld.com
